Nick Shulman responded:  2019-08-16 11:18
I am not sure that I understand what you are saying.
Skyline does not normally get any information about proteins from peptide search results.
When you specify a FASTA file during "Import Peptide Search", Skyline uses your enzyme settings to digest the proteins in the FASTA file and sees whether any of those digested peptide sequences match any of the peptides sequences in your search results or SSL file.
